[Issue 7551] New: Regex parsing bug for right bracket in character class
http://d.puremagic.com/issues/show_bug.cgi?id=7551 Summary: Regex parsing bug for right bracket in character class Product: D Version: D2 Platform: All OS/Version: All Status: NEW Severity: normal Priority: P2 Component: Phobos AssignedTo: nob...@puremagic.com ReportedBy: mag...@hetland.org --- Comment #0 from Magnus Lie Hetland 2012-02-20 03:06:36 PST --- It seems that a bug has appeared for charsets in the std.regex. In previous versions, a right bracket could be included in a character set by placing it first, as is the case in many other languages/libraries. In the current version (I'm using the canned DMD 2.058 for OS X), that doesn't work: import std.regex; void main() { auto r = regex("[]]"); } This gives the following exception: std.regex.RegexException@/usr/share/dmd/src/phobos/std/regex.d(1951): wrong CodepointSet Pattern with error: `[]` <--HERE-- `]` This should probably be permitted, as a "least surprise" practice, and to preserve compatibility with older versions. (It doesn't seem to be explicitly documented in the standard library docs, though. Then again, as far as I can see, no other mechanism for including right brackets in charsets is documented either.) -- Configure issuemail: http://d.puremagic.com/issues/userprefs.cgi?tab=email --- You are receiving this mail because: ---

[Issue 7554] New: Immutable function pointer arguments too
http://d.puremagic.com/issues/show_bug.cgi?id=7554 Summary: Immutable function pointer arguments too Product: D Version: D2 Platform: x86 OS/Version: Windows Status: NEW Keywords: rejects-valid Severity: normal Priority: P2 Component: DMD AssignedTo: nob...@puremagic.com ReportedBy: bearophile_h...@eml.cc --- Comment #0 from bearophile_h...@eml.cc 2012-02-20 14:51:48 PST --- This problem may be correlated to Issue 7500 This code doesn't compile because 'foo' is mutable: T outer(T)(T function(in T) pure foo) pure { pure int inner() { return foo(5); } return inner(); } int sqr(in int x) pure { return x * x; } void main() { assert(outer(&sqr) == 25); } test.d(3): Error: pure nested function 'inner' cannot access mutable data 'foo' test.d(11): Error: template instance test.outer!(int) error instantiating But it doesn't work if you add an 'immutable': T outer(T)(immutable T function(in T) pure foo) pure { pure int inner() { return foo(5); } return inner(); } int sqr(in int x) pure { return x * x; } void main() { assert(outer(&sqr) == 25); } test.d(11): Error: template test.outer(T) cannot deduce template function from argument types !()(int function(const(int) x) pure) This compiles, but it's not nice: int sqr(in int x) pure { return x * x; } immutable sqrPtr =&sqr; auto outer(typeof(sqrPtr) foo) pure { pure int inner() { return foo(5); } return inner(); } void main() { assert(outer(sqrPtr) == 25); } A better workaround, found by Timon Gehr: T outer(T)(T function(in T) pure foo) pure { immutable fooTick = foo; pure int inner() { return fooTick(5); } return inner(); } int sqr(in int x) pure { return x * x; } void main() { assert(outer(&sqr) == 25); } -- Configure issuemail: http://d.puremagic.com/issues/userprefs.cgi?tab=email --- You are receiving this mail because: ---
